Community Outreach at Wellstar

Wellstar Health System is a nonprofit organization and is committed to being an engaged community partner. At Wellstar, we are more than healthcare, we are PeopleCare, and our passion for people extends into the communities we serve. We are committed to elevating the health and well-being of our community through outreach and partnership that honors all voices.

Wellstar relies on and values our community partners and the role they play in positively impacting the health and well-being of every person we serve.

Wellstar partners with mission-aligned and other non-profit organizations to address priority health needs and social determinants of health as defined through our Community Health Needs Assessments, and that also further a social cause and provide community benefit.

We work alongside our business and civic partners and leaders to amplify health awareness, contribute to economic development and growth, and to help our communities thrive through service.

We also partner with both academic and other organizations dedicated to career development to help prepare the next generation of caregivers and healthcare workers in both clinical and non-clinical capacities.

In addition to community partnerships, Wellstar also engages in our community through corporate volunteerism, sponsorships, event participation and speaking engagements that align with our areas of focus. Primary Care Opens Doors to Behavioral Health at Wellstar

What started as a research study has grown into a systemwide commitment at Wellstar to improve access to mental and emotional healthcare. By embedding licensed mental health practitioners in the primary care settings, Wellstar is making it easier for patients to receive behavioral health services alongside their routine medical care. 

Today, licensed clinical social workers (LCSW) work alongside primary care providers and pediatricians in more than a dozen Wellstar practices. And there are plans to grow that number.

“With social workers just steps away from an exam room, primary care physicians can make ‘warm handoffs’ for immediate behavioral health support,” said Dr. Jeffrey Tharp, chief medicine division officer for Wellstar.

“It helps lower barriers to mental health and substance use disorder treatment. And it removes some of the stigma some people associate with mental healthcare.”

Dr. Sophie Arkin, a psychologist in Wellstar’s Suicide Prevention department, said, “This is a great way to reach people who might otherwise fall through the cracks. It gives them a real opportunity to live a different life.”

Primary care clinicians connect adults to behavioral health specialists

Nearly 10 years ago, Wellstar was one of several health systems nationally that participated in a study of the effects of placing behavioral health clinicians in primary care.

The need is significant. Mental illness and substance use disorders are prevalent throughout the U.S. According to the 2024 State of Mental Health in America report, 22.5% of adults in Georgia had a mental illness in the past year. The report also said that 17% had a substance use disorder.

Primary care physicians at Wellstar routinely screen patients for depression, suicidal thoughts and alcohol or drug use. In other cases, they learn from conversations that patients may have:

  • Anxiety or panic disorders
  • Sleep disturbances
  • Stress related to work, family life or finances
  • Grief or unresolved trauma

Introducing the behavioral health clinician

When behavioral concerns emerge, the primary care team introduces the on-site clinical social worker. This specialist conducts an in-depth assessment to determine the next best steps for the patient. This is typically a short-term series of sessions that may lead to referrals to psychiatrists, psychologists or Wellstar’s suicide prevention team.

“One of the biggest strengths of this model is credibility,” Dr. Tharp said. “If a physician or nurse practitioner you trust says, ‘We have a counselor here I’d like you to meet,’ the patient is more likely to follow through.”

This model has proven especially effective for patients who are less likely to seek mental health support, such as men, seniors and caregivers.

Where primary and behavioral health cross paths

People with chronic conditions like diabetes, digestive disorders and kidney disease sometimes have or develop mental health conditions like depression and anxiety. As a result, patients may find it harder to:

  • Get the follow-up testing and care they need
  • Follow nutrition and exercise instructions
  • Take medications according to their doctor’s instructions

Not treating behavioral health issues can contribute to patients’ worsening physical health and higher medical costs.

Conversely, many patients may go to their primary care physician because they’re having trouble breathing, their heart is pounding or they have frequent headaches. Or they’re sweating or feel faint, dizzy or nauseated.

Those can be signs of a medical problem. They can also be symptoms of an emotional or mental health issue. In that case, a behavioral health clinician is around the office corner.

“We know that stress and anxiety show up in lots of different ways in the body. Understanding that allows people to adopt a new philosophy about how to take care of themselves,” Dr. Arkin said.

Pediatricians screen and refer children for behavioral health

Childhood and adolescence are critical periods in development. Mental health issues can affect a child’s ability to learn, grow and develop healthy relationships both now and as an adult.

Pediatricians routinely screen children for behavioral health concerns. They ask questions about social, emotional and behavioral development. Screenings for autism risk begin in early childhood and depression screenings begin at age 12.

At Wellstar KenMar Pediatrics in Marietta and Kennesaw, pediatricians turn to their in-house behavioral health partner, Dr. Kayla Fitch. Common reasons to refer include:

  • Behavior challenges
  • Feeding disorders, such as extreme picky eating
  • Mental health issues among children with chronic or acute illnesses
  • Requests for att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) evaluations
  • Severe social or separation anxiety

While under her care, Dr. Fitch screens patients for anxiety and suicide risk.

“One of the things I’m the most passionate about is early anxiety treatment for kids. We can help kids when they’re 4, 5, 6 years old,” Dr. Fitch said. “I teach parents basic concepts around how to expose their children to anxiety-producing situations to decrease their anxiety.”

She helps children learn “coping strategies, like deep breathing and muscle relaxation. These are things kids can benefit from if we teach them creatively.”

Growing commitment to integrated care

Wellstar’s primary care model continues to evolve to meet the behavioral health needs of patients throughout their life. Time will bring even more collaboration and improved outcomes.

“It serves everyone—patients, families and doctors—to create these seamless connections between primary and behavioral health practitioners,” Dr. Tharp said. “We see the benefits every single day in our patients’ health and their outlooks.”

Wellstar Cobb Medical Center Celebrates Opening of Obstetric Emergency Department

Wellstar Cobb Medical Center hosted a ribbon-cutting ceremony to celebrate the opening of its Obstetric Emergency Department, offering 24/7 specialized care for pregnant and postpartum patients.

Hospital and system leaders gathered alongside community partners to mark the milestone, including Cobb County Commissioner Monique Sheffield, Wellstar Chief of Women’s Health Dr. Paula Greaves and Wellstar Cobb President Eliese Bernard.

“As we continue building the vision for women’s health at Wellstar Cobb, this new Obstetric Emergency Department represents an important step forward for our community,” said Bernard. “We’re proud to be the first in our area to deliver dedicated emergency care for pregnant and postpartum patients, and to give families a caring, reassuring place when they need it most.”

Photo collage celebrating the opening of Wellstar Cobb Medical Center Obstetric Emergency Department

The Obstetric Emergency Department provides expert evaluation and treatment for patients who are 20 weeks pregnant through six weeks postpartum. Patients have direct access to board-certified obstetric providers, supported by a coordinated team of maternal-fetal medicine specialists, anesthesiologists, neonatologists, nurses and midwives.

Services include rapid care for urgent pregnancy concerns, management of pregnancy-related conditions such as hypertension or gestational diabetes, and monitoring for postpartum complications. Families also receive compassionate guidance and resources, including support during high-risk pregnancies or loss.

“Pregnancy can bring moments of uncertainty and having immediate access to obstetric experts can make all the difference,” said Dr. Jessica Williams, OB/GYN medical director at Wellstar Cobb. “The Obstetric Emergency Department allows us to respond quickly, provide clarity and help families feel supported from the moment they walk through the door.”

Georgia continues to experience one of the highest maternal mortality rates in the nation, with disparities particularly affecting Black women. Many of these outcomes are preventable with timely access to specialized care. The Obstetric Emergency Department at Wellstar Cobb helps address these challenges by advancing Wellstar’s commitment to reducing maternal health disparities and improving perinatal outcomes. The department ensures patients receive the right care, in the right place, at the right time and in a safe and supportive environment.

This expansion of maternal care services enhances Wellstar Cobb’s comprehensive Women’s Center and complements its full-service Labor & Delivery program and Level III Neonatal Intensive Care Unit, reinforcing Wellstar’s mission to deliver world-class healthcare to every patient and family we serve.

Augusta-Metro community gets first look inside Wellstar Columbia County Medical Center

Clad in hard hats and neon construction vests, civic leaders and the media took their first look inside the long-awaited Wellstar Columbia County Medical Center on Nov. 14. Led by the hospital’s newly appointed Chief Operating Officer, Nelson So, groups toured the pharmacy, infusion space, operating rooms, and emergency department. Also on display was a nearly finished patient room featuring large windows for plenty of natural light and a digital whiteboard where patients can easily keep track of their medical information.

“This community has been asking for a hospital, and we’re going to deliver that to them in 2026,” So said.
